About TrailDB
TrailDB is an open-source C library designed for fast querying and efficient storage of event series. It leverages time-based data predictability to achieve high compression ratios while maintaining query speed. Originally developed by AdRoll to process tens of trillions of web events, TrailDB offers a simple API, multiple language bindings, and is optimized for both development speed and data compression.
FAQ
TrailDB supports C, Python, Go, R, Haskell, and D.
TrailDB can process millions of events per second on a single core.
TrailDB leverages predictability of time-based data to compress your data to a fraction of its original size.
Yes, you can query the encoded data directly, decompressing only the parts you need.
TrailDB can be used to compute metrics like bounce rate, analyze usage patterns, detect anomalies, cluster and predict user behavior.
TrailDB has over 90% test coverage, ensuring reliability.
You can find help or ask questions on the TrailDB channel at Gitter.
Alternatives to consider
Community ratings & full listResources
Pricing summary
Model
Open source
Categories
Claim this tool
Are you the founder? Claim your profile to update details and track views.
Claim tool